Checklist
- Request batch photographs and a packing list prior to shipment.
- Review the reorder point after one full selling cycle.
- Check carton quantities against the commercial invoice line by line.
- Log sell through by account for the first eight weeks.
- Retain one sealed sample carton from every batch for reference.
- Keep certificates current and filed against the exact model name.

Frequently asked questions
Should a Fat Rabbit 2 distributorship be exclusive?
Only against a defined volume commitment; open terms with a review point are safer for a first year.
What happens if a batch fails inspection?
The agreed procedure normally covers replacement of affected units or credit against the next order, documented before shipment.
Can several models be mixed in one shipment?
Yes, mixing models and flavours within a carton or pallet is common and usually helps first time buyers test demand.
Can packaging be adjusted for our market?
Artwork localisation is straightforward; structural changes need larger volumes and a longer lead time.
